Guys need your help ,I shorted out my Schulze speedy the other night and fryd her :diablo: We are 1 week out from our state titles and the only replacment speedy i can get my hands on is a mamba maxx ,is this ESC going to be OK to use with my Lehner ?? any help would be great & if you can get me another speedy to Perth Western Australia by friday some how please drop me a line .:neutral:
|
Mamba Max will work great with Lehner motors, at least up to 4s (with UBEC). Some have had luck at 5s as well, but that may be asking too much.
|
Just make sure you send Serum a pic of the toasted esc for his collection! The MM should be fin on upto 4s & 100amps or so- what lehner is it exactly?
|
i have a MM paired with a LMT 1940/7 hi amp... it runs smooth as silk on 4s a123 packs. haven't really tried it out thoroughly yet on 5s2p. if you overgear it, it won't cog but you can tell it's smoother when geared correctly.
